A metal spiral staircase sits in the middle of this 2 1/2 storey conservation shophouse. It is gently tilted towards the front and spirals upwards over the 3 floors to end in the attic space over the well lit jack roof. At the rear, a reflecting pond sits below a light and air well with a playful pattern of aluminium slats. The house is completely open on the first storey and ends in a delightful bamboo court. On the second storey, the two bathrooms are cladded in the same aluminium slats that is used in the staircase. One of the bathrooms have a pregnant bulge where the bath tub sits.
